The Common Intermediates of Oxygen Evolution and Dissolution Reactions during Water Electrolysis on Iridium
Understanding the pathways of catalyst degradation during the oxygen evolution reaction is a cornerstone in the development of efficient and stable electrolyzers, since even for the most promising Ir based anodes the harsh reaction conditions are detrimental.
